Supported Applications
The Omega CSH4 Series consists of ceramic-insulated, flat-surface heating elements with a seamless Type 304 Stainless Steel sheath. These channel strip heaters are designed for industrial and commercial heating applications including ovens, hot plates, dies, molds, drying processes, melting, baking, incubators, platens, food warmers, welding preheating, air heating, sealing bars, thermoforming, and tank heating.
Operating Conditions & Performance
The series features a maximum sheath temperature of 650°C (1200°F). Electrical specifications support a maximum voltage of 480 Vac (dependent on design parameters) with a maximum recommended voltage of 480V when using lead wire terminations. Amperage limits are defined by the termination method: Lead Wire Termination supports up to 10 amp, while Screw Terminations (10-32UNF) support up to 25 amp.
Performance ratings include a nominal watt density of 20 Watts/in² (3.1 Watts/cm²), with a maximum watt density of 45 Watts/in² dependent on design parameters. Tolerances are specified as Resistance: 10%, -5% and Wattage: 5%, -10%. The heaters utilize a rectangular tube construction to maximize heat transfer.
Configuration Options
The CSH4 Series is offered in four standard rectangular sizes with specific availability constraints regarding mounting tabs:
- 16 W x 6 mm thick (5/8" x 1/4"): Available without mounting tabs only.
- 25 W x 8 mm thick (1" x 5/16"): Available with or without mounting tabs. When supplied with Type L lead wire termination, mounting tabs are not available.
- 38 W x 8 mm thick (1 1/2" x 5/16"): Available with or without mounting tabs. When supplied with Type L lead wire termination, mounting tabs are not available.
- 38 W x 10 mm thick (1 1/2" x 3/8"): Available with or without mounting tabs; these heaters feature radius corners. Mounting tabs are not available when supplied with Type L lead wire termination.
Termination options include Screw Terminal Terminations: Type T1 (10-32 Screw Terminals at each end), Type T2 (Tandem at one end), Type T3 (Parallel at one end), and Type T4 (Offset at one end). Lead Wire Terminations are available as Type L (exit from end) or Type L1 (exit from top).
Terminal protection options include Igloo™ ceramic covers: Type C6 (Double Port In-Line), Type C7 (Double Port 90°), and Type C8 (Single Port). Additional cable protections include wire braid, stainless steel braid, armor cable, right-angle armor cable, high-temperature quick disconnect plugs, terminal boxes, or specially designed welded boxes.
Key Product Differences
The series distinguishes between configurations with and without mounting tabs. Heaters supplied without mounting tabs have ends that are silver soldered shut to prevent moisture and contaminants from entering the heater. Mounting slots for standard installation measure 8 x 13 mm (5/16 x 1/2"), while special bushings of 13 x 16 mm (1/2 x 5/8") are available.
Physical construction tolerances vary by dimension: Width tolerance is +0.000, -0.005" for 16 mm wide heaters and +0.000, -0.010" for 25 mm and 38 mm wide heaters. Thickness tolerance is +0.000, -0.005" for 6 mm thick heaters and +0.000, -0.008" for 8 and 10 mm thick heaters. Length tolerances are ±1/16" up to 24" and ±1/8" over 24".
